To distribute a product, you first have to make sales. Many small entrepreneurial companies are unable to field a large sales force, so they use independent sales representatives who will sell their products, along with those of other businesses, for a contracted commission. If you consider contracting with an independent sales representative, this checklist will help you evaluate each representative you are considering.
